What a life, what a legacy. R.I.P president Carter. Not many can claim to be architects of eliminating a neglected tropical disease. I will remember him for his dedication to ending guinea worm and for all the homes built by habitat for humanity. All else are footnotes. www.ajc.com/news/former-...

When The Carter Center began leading the international campaign to eradicate Guinea worm disease in 1986, there were an estimated 3.5 million cases in at least 21 countries in Africa and Asia. Today, that number has been reduced by more than 99.99%. In 2024 so far there have been 7 cases. #legacy
